Colorado Springs Fine Arts Center’s “Putting It Together”

Sept. 10-27: Musical revue featuring the music and lyrics of Stephen Sondheim. $20-$42. 30 West Dale St., Colorado Springs; 719-634-5581 or .

Denver Center Performing Arts’ “Matilda: The Musical”

Sept. 9-20: National Broadway tour of the Tony Award-winning musical based on the Roald Dahl book about a precocious young girl with the gift of telekinesis. $30-$105. Buell Theatre, 13th and Curtis streets, Denver; 303-893-4100 or .

The Edge Theater’s “American Girls”

Sept. 4-27: In a celebrity-driven culture, two God-fearing Iowa girls have their sights set on big things. $26. 1560 Teller St., Lakewood; 303-232-0363 or .

Midtown Arts Center’s “Rock of Ages”

Sept. 10-Nov. 29: Humorous musical spoof on ’80s hair bands that features a love story set on the Sunset Strip, and a bar-full of 1980s rock. $54-$64. 3750 S. Mason St., Fort Collins; 970-225-2555 or .

OpenStage Theatre’s “Stage Kiss”

Sept. 5-Oct. 3: When two actors with a history are thrown together as leads in an old melodrama, they lose touch with reality in this romantic comedy by Sarah Ruhl. $12-$24. Magnolia Theatre, Lincoln Center, 417 W. Magnolia St., Fort Collins; 970-221-6730 or .

TheatreWorks’ “Private Lives”

Sept. 10-27:Cutting comedy that skewers marriage and romantic entanglement, set on the Riviera during two divorcees’ honeymoon. $18-$36. Dusty Loo Bon Vivant Theater, 3955 Regent Circle, Colorado Springs; 719-255-3232 or .

Vintage Theatre’s “Any Given Monday”

Sept. 4-Oct. 25: : A comedy for the men who love football and the women who despise it. $24-$28. 1468 Dayton St., Aurora; 303-856-7830 or .
